What is BISP Taleemi Wazaif?

The Benazir Taleemi Wazaif Program 2025 is a vital education support initiative under the Benazir Income Support Programme (BISP). It provides monthly educational stipends to children from low-income families, ensuring they can continue schooling without financial barriers.
This BISP education program covers students from primary to intermediate levels, helping parents manage costs like books, uniforms, and transport. By encouraging parents to keep their children in school, BISP Taleemi Wazaif plays a key role in reducing dropout rates and promoting literacy across Pakistan.

Eligibility Criteria for Taleemi Wazaif 2025

To access the BISP Taleemi Wazaif payments, families must meet specific eligibility conditions defined by the Government of Pakistan.

  • Parents or guardians must be enrolled under the BISP Kafalat Program
  • Children must be between 4 to 22 years old
  • The child must be enrolled in a recognized educational institution
  • Minimum 70% school attendance is required
  • Children should not be involved in child labor or work

These eligibility rules guarantee that only genuine beneficiaries receive the Benazir education stipends, ensuring fairness and accountability in the system.

Updated Stipend Amounts for 2025

The government has revised the BISP Taleemi Wazaif 2025 stipend rates to provide better financial assistance and promote girls’ education across Pakistan.

Education LevelBoys (Monthly)Girls (Monthly)
Primary SchoolRs. 1,500Rs. 2,000
Middle SchoolRs. 2,500Rs. 3,000
High SchoolRs. 3,500Rs. 4,000
IntermediateRs. 4,500Rs. 5,000

Girls receive higher stipends under the BISP education scholarship program, encouraging equal learning opportunities and improving female enrollment in schools.

How to Register Online for BISP Taleemi Wazaif 2025

Parents can now register their children for Benazir Taleemi Wazaif online 2025 through a simple digital process.

  • Visit the 8171 Web Portal
  • Enter the guardian’s CNIC number
  • Provide student details including school name and class
  • The school verifies attendance digitally
  • Confirmation is received via SMS from 8171

This BISP online registration system removes the need for office visits and makes the process faster and more convenient for families across urban and rural areas.

How to Check BISP Taleemi Wazaif Payments Online

Beneficiaries can check their BISP payment status 2025 through two official methods.

Method 1: Web Portal

  • Open the 8171 BISP website
  • Enter CNIC and registered mobile number
  • View payment status and attendance records instantly

Method 2: SMS Service

  • Send your CNIC number to 8171
  • Receive payment details and updates directly via text message

Both options make it easier for families to monitor their Benazir Taleemi Wazaif installments anytime and anywhere.

Addressing Challenges for Families

While the new digital BISP system is highly efficient, some families still face difficulties due to limited internet access and lack of awareness.
To resolve these issues, BISP help desks have been established at schools and regional offices. These centers assist parents with online registration, attendance verification, and payment checks, ensuring no deserving family is left behind.
